  • Patent number: 6870273
    Abstract: Gridded I/O pads for flip-chip packages in which a coaxial-like solder bump pad configuration is used in which the I/O pads closest to the signal or bump pad are power or ground pads. The ground pads surrounding the signal pad form a coaxial-like pad configuration for impedance matching at the transition from die to package substrate. The ground pads surrounding the signal pad may be connected by a metal trace to form a ground pad ring. The invention employs conductor-backed ground coplanar waveguides (GCPW), which match impedance at connections between I/O cells and signal pads to enhance signal transmission, avoid reflection and leakage, and provide superior electromagnetic shielding. The present invention also supports high quantities of I/Os for a given die size, and supports flexible power and ground placement.

  • Patent number: 6808692
    Abstract: A method of treating a coal combustion flue gas, which includes injecting a molecular halogen or thermolabile molecular halogen precursor, such as calcium hypochlorite, able to decompose to form molecular halogen at flue gas temperature. The molecular halogen converts elemental mercury to mercuric halide, which is adsorbable by alkaline solids such as subbituminous or lignite coal ash, alkali fused bituminous coal ash, and dry flue gas desulphurization solids, capturable in whole or part by electrostatic precipitators (ESPs), baghouses (BHs), and fabric filters (FFs), with or without subsequent adsorption by a liquid such as a flue gas desulphurization scrubbing liquor.

  • Patent number: 6301137
    Abstract: In a three-phase DC-to-AC inverter including, for driving each leg of the load, a controlled power driver such a pulse-width modulated field-effect transistor (FET) or insulated gate bipolar transistor (IGBT) pair, an estimator for estimating the current in each leg of the load. A low-resistance leg resistor is connected in series in the lower leg of each transistor pair. The voltages across the leg resistors are applied to two differential amplifiers to generate two discrete voltage difference values that are transmitted to an estimator. The estimator solves specified differential equations using suitably interconnected combiners, integrators, amplifiers and multipliers, or discrete digital equivalent or programmed computer equivalent, to derive a value for the estimated current in each leg of the load.
